Jordan Spieth + Explorer

It's no secret many golfers wear Rolex (many are even sponsored). If you follow this sort of thing, Jordan Spieth was wearing his Explorer 16570 when he won the Masters. He won the Travelers Championship today (what a finish) and was wearing his Explorer...but this time on a nato! Just thought it was neat that he likes to swap out the bracelet every once in awhile, :)

Jordan Spieth + Explorer

He is a Rolex ambassador, but he may be one of us. Seen him wear 5 and 6 digit EXP II, Daytona C and the 6 digit BLRO. The fact he wears a 5 digit on a NATO would suggest he does that because he likes it. Doubt corporate Rolex would push him to wear that set up.
Great reaction to the win yesterday. Some of these guys are like robots. Nice to see some real emotion.
He is in rarified air, joining Jack and Tiger as the only players in history with 10 wins at 24 years old.
